USITC Makes Decision on Cut-to-Length Carbon Steel Plate

06 December 2011 - The U.S. International Trade Commission determined that revoking the existing antidumping and countervailing duty orders on cut-to-length carbon-quality steel plate from India, Indonesia, and Korea would be likely to lead to continuation or recurrence of material injury within a reasonably foreseeable time. The existing orders on imports of these products from Italy and Japan will be revoked as a result of the Commission's negative determinations.

World Crude Steel Production Rebounds Slightly in October

22 November 2011 - World crude steel production for the 64 countries reporting to the World Steel Association stood at an estimated 123.98 million tonnes for October 2011, 0.3% higher than the 123.57 million tonnes reported for the previous month (September 2011) and 6.2% higher in comparison with October 2010.

September Steel Shipments Down 4.3% from August

18 November 2011 - U.S. steel mills shipped 7,947,262 net tons for the month of September 2011, a 4.3% decrease from the 8,304,638 net tons shipped in the previous month according to the latest report from AISI.

Severstal Columbus Unveils $550 Million Phase II Facility Expansion

18 November 2011 - everstal North America celebrated the Grand Opening of its $550-million Phase II expansion in Columbus, Miss. The expansion included installation of a second EAF, caster, tunnel furnace, hot-dip galvanizing line, and push-pull pickle line.
